    What constitutes 30 days notice?

    This is one of the most misunderstood things in law: 30 days notice is a Minimum number of days required for notice. If your lease ends May 30 and you give your notice on January 1st that you are leaving May 30th, it operates as a "30 day notice." 30 day notice does not mean that you will be...
